Tanks such as Pz.Kpfw.III and Pz.Kpfw.IV could be towed by a single 18 ton heavy half-track, but heavy tanks such as the Tiger I or Panther required three or more towing vehicles. In that case, about 5 meters of wire rope was used to link each of the half-tracks together. Except for emergency situations, a draw-bar was used for the tank\/half-track linkage instead of wire rope. After the linkage was complete, a commander and signalman boarded the lead half-track, directing the other half-tracks by a series of hand signals.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eLargest Half-Track in the German Army\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eDetailed information on the finished FAMO is presented one month after the initial report of the mock-up. The Yukikaze was the 8th completed destroyer built of the Kagero-class in January 1940. The Yukikaze saw fierce action at Midway, Guadalcanal, Mariana Islands, Leyte Gulf, as well as serving in other battles throughout the Pacific Theater. Furthermore, she also served as a patrol ship and assisted in transportation duties. At the time of her completion, she initially came armed with three dual 12.7cm gun turrets and two quadruple 61cm torpedo launchers, but in the latter stages of the War, her armament was strengthened with a complement of AA guns as well as radar changing her beautiful silhouette into one of ferociousness. Even at the Ten-Ichi-Go operation in April 1945 where she fought hard alongside with the doomed Yamato, she was able to save many survivors and return safely to port. The Yukikaze survived WWII relatively undamaged she was therefore named \"the Lucky Destroyer\". After the war, she was used to ferry Japanese soldiers and personnel back to Japan. Later, she was transferred to the Republic of China for war reparation and served with distinction throughout the 1960s.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eFeatures\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eLength: 338mm, Width: 31mm. The USS New Jersey, affectionately known as the \"Big J,\" was the second ship of this class and saw service in WWII from early-1944. However, the advent of carrier airpower changed the nature of naval warfare and New Jersey was withdrawn from frontline duty after WWII in 1948. She was reactivated to participate in the Korean War and Vietnam War, but was again placed in reserve in 1969. However, thanks to President Reagan's policy of strengthening the navy, the modernization of the Iowa-class was proposed in 1981 and New Jersey was chosen as the first ship to undergo this program. She was equipped with new weaponry including Tomahawk cruise missiles, Harpoon anti-ship missiles, and Phalanx CIWS as well as new radars, ECM, and other electronic systems. She served as a missile-carrying battleship until her final decommissioning in 1991 and was eventually stricken from the U.S. Navy register in 1995. USS New Jersey was then restored to become a floating museum in Philadelphia.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eFeatures\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e1\/350 scale plastic assembly kit depicts the USS New Jersey as she appeared in 1982. A truly massive ship, it had a waterline length of 256m, a beam of 38.9m, a displacement of around 70,000 tons and nine 46cm guns which had a maximum range of 41km and were capable of piercing 43cm of armor from 30km away. Her armor, meanwhile, weighed in at an staggering 21,000 tons. The hull of the ship had been kept as short as was possible, with defensive considerations meaning the bridge, gun turrets and mechanical sections concentrated in the center of the vessel. Beneath the waterline, she employed a bulbous bow that protruded 3 meters and contributed to increased wavemaking resistance. She featured in actions including the Battle of Leyte Gulf and the Battle of Midway. On April 7th 1945 she came under attack from over three hundred U.S. aircraft while on the way to Okinawa, sinking to the bottom of the ocean.\u003c\/p\u003e\r\n\u003ch3\u003eFeatures\u003c\/h3\u003e\r\n\u003cul\u003e\r\n\u003cli\u003eThis is a plastic model assembly kit of the Japanese battleship Yamato.\u003cbr\u003eScale: 1\/350, Length: 751.5mm, Width: 110mm.\u003c\/li\u003e\r\n\u003cli\u003eDetailed one-piece molded hull includes accurate recreations of the famous bulbous bow.\u003c\/li\u003e\r\n\u003cli\u003eBridge, funnel and other parts concentrated in the center of the ship are faithfully replicated, giving the model a highly realistic feel.\u003c\/li\u003e\r\n\u003cli\u003eDetails such as the sonar and main masts are depicted using precise engraving.\u003c\/li\u003e\r\n\u003cli\u003eTriple 45-caliber 46cm gun turrets feature waterproof covers and are attached individually to the deck. The Chinook's primary mission is moving artillery, ammunition, personnel, and supplies on the battlefield. It also performs rescue, aeromedical, parachuting, aircraft recovery and special operations missions. Early production CH-47A’s operated with the 11th Air Assault Division during 1963 and in October of that year the aircraft was formally designated as the Army’s standard medium transport helicopter. In June 1965 the 11th Air Assault Division was redesignated as the 1st Cavalry Division (Airmobile) and readied for deployment to Viet Nam. Chinooks from the 11th Air Assault formed the nucleus of the 228th Assault Helicopter Battalion which began operations in Viet Nam in September, 1965. As of February 1966, 161 aircraft had been delivered to the Army.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eSpecification\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eScale: 1:35\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eModel Brief: Length:442mm Wide:110mm\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Total Parts: 323pcs\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eMetal Parts: Landing gear\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003ePhoto Etched Parts: 1pcs\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eFilm Parts: Instrument part\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Total Sprues: 16pcs\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003ePaint Schemes 228th ASHB, 1st Cav Div(Airmobile),Lai Khe,Vietnam1970\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e","brand":"TRUMPETER","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":12968590442549,"sku":"TR05104","price":189.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0024\/8617\/3749\/products\/trumpeter_1_35_helicopter_ch-47a_chinook_tr05104z_5.jpg?v=1571709182"},{"product_id":"trumpeter-1-350-u-s-cv-9-essex","title":"Trumpeter 05602 1\/350 U.S. CV-9 Essex","description":"\u003cp\u003eUSS Essex (CV\/CVA\/CVS-9) was an aircraft carrier and the lead ship of the 24-ship Essex class built for the United States Navy during World War II. It is fired from a turntable affording a 360degree traverse. The gun has a 70-foot 8-inch barrel held in a sleeve-type cradle. The barrel recoil mechanism, fitted between two arms projecting downward from the cradle, consists of two hydro pneumatic cylinders and a single hydraulic buffer cylinder. A central jack helps support the tremendous weight of the gun and carriage, which amounts to around 230 tons and also serves as a central pivot for the turntable. The German Leopold Gun was the largest weapon, which lobbed shells at American troops at \"Anzio Beach\".\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e Leopold supported by 24 railcar wheels, was mounted on railroad tracks, which led in and out of mountain tunnels. When not firing, the gun was rolled back into the tunnels out of the sight of Allied reconnaissance. Although both guns had been extensively damaged, Allied forces were able to salvage the Leopold and after reconstruction of the railway, moved the gun to Naples for shipment to the United States. \"Anzio Annie\" as the gun was known to the Allied troops at Anzio, is the only German railroad gun known to have survived World War II. The Leopold is currently on display at the Aberdeen Proving Ground in Aberdeen, Maryland.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eLength: 959 mm\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eWidth: 128mm\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eHeight:160mm\u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eScale: 1\/35\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eItem Type: Static Armor\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Total Parts: 1140pcs\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eMetal Parts: Rail chain\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003ePhoto Etched Parts: For (chimney brace frame) grills\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Total Sprues: 26pcs sprues +4pcs hull assembly plate +2pcs truck upper decks +18 sections railway\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003ePaint Schemes: For German Panzer Division France 1941\/ Italy 1944\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eMore Features: Engine detail\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e","brand":"TRUMPETER","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":39629769998470,"sku":"TR00207","price":189.99,"currency_code":"AUD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0024\/8617\/3749\/products\/trumpeter_1-35_280mm_k5_e_leopold_german_rail_road_gun_tr000207z.png?v=1571709189"},{"product_id":"trumpeter-1-48-grumman-h-21-albatros","title":"Trumpeter 02821 1\/48 Grumman H-21 Albatros","description":"\u003cp\u003eHU-16 \"albatross\" by the United States Gurnuman aircraft company, which is equipped with two 1425 hp R-1820-76D piston engine.
